Output 14d58fa728eef274825e30b4122523883d785f8087f6398755f13dffa1d01e79:2

value
29530365
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1d4b58b222b22364f33de883a4950eeba709551 OP_EQUAL
address
MVwqtxCK8gyPceZLPvXbHkQuXo67d8V3y4
transaction
14d58fa728eef274825e30b4122523883d785f8087f6398755f13dffa1d01e79
spent
true